Output 31ac3755d5c13881ea8fd10d05f674c2478663ccfcf25daa1d270b3fd54a5b53:1

value
18620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6d6741094ff68ed53c32cc820b8edb1d747eba OP_EQUAL
address
9sZyqAjy9dEC2TNAUfwCYBQiEskdSdG8ZU
transaction
31ac3755d5c13881ea8fd10d05f674c2478663ccfcf25daa1d270b3fd54a5b53